The 3rd Annual Lansingburgh Connects Hockey Clash

Thank you to everyone who came out to watch, our participating teams, and our sponsors of the 3rd Annual Lansingburgh Connects Hockey Clash. A special thank you to Troy Mayor Carmella Mantello for dropping the puck at our championship game!
With increased participation we were able to raise DOUBLE what we did last year! All funds went directly to our community outreach program, Lansingburgh Connects, designed to link students and families to mental health and social supports to bolster student educational achievement and improve health and well-being.
